使用C#调用windows API入门 一:入门, 直接从 C# 调用 DLL 导出 其实我们的议题应该叫做C#如何直接调用非托管代码,通常有2种方法: 1. 直接调用从 DLL 导出的函数 ...
一:入门, 直接从 C 调用 DLL 导出 其实我们的议题应该叫做C 如何直接调用非托管代码,通常有 种方法: 直接调用从DLL导出的函数。 调用COM对象上的接口方法 我主要讨论从dll中导出函数,基本步骤如下: 使用C 关键字 static和 extern声明方法。 将 DllImport属性附加到该方法。 DllImport属性允许您指定包含该方法的DLL的名称。 如果需要,为方法的参数和 ...
2014-03-21 14:46 1 2454 推荐指数:
使用C#调用windows API入门 一:入门, 直接从 C# 调用 DLL 导出 其实我们的议题应该叫做C#如何直接调用非托管代码,通常有2种方法: 1. 直接调用从 DLL 导出的函数 ...
使用VS创建windows服务项目: 创建好项目 会出现一个设计界面 右键弹出对话框 选择添加安装程序 名字什么的自己可以改: 项目目录: 打开项目中的ProjectInstaller.Designer.cs 修改windows服务名称描述以及启动方式 ...
界面如下: 下面放了一个PictureBox 首先是声明函数: 截图按钮事件代码: 设置图片质量的函数,详细介绍:http://www.cnblogs.c ...
。Visual C#和其它开发工具一样也能够调用动态链接库的API函 数。.NET框架本身提供了这样一种服务,允许 ...
获取Token 保存数据 上传文件 ...
使用C#调用windows API(从其它地方总结来的,以备查询) C#调用windows API也可以叫做C#如何直接调用非托管代码,通常有2种方法: 1. 直接调用从 DLL 导出的函数。 2. 调用 COM 对象上的接口方法 我主要讨论从dll中导出函数,基本步骤如下: 1. ...
导入winmm.dll中的函数mciSendString 需要注意的是,所有命令需要在同一个线程中,才可以对同一个midi实例进行控制。该函数通过字符串向声卡发送指令,常见的用于播放midi文 ...
一、调用Windows API。 C#下调用Windows API方法如下: 1、引入命名空间:using System.Runtime.InteropServices; 2、引用需要使用的方法,格式:[DllImport("DLL文件")]方法的声明; [DllImport ...